. Charlotte buys two biscuits and a carton of milk for $5.00.
Oliver buys three biscuits and a carton of milk for $6.50.
How much more does a carton of milk cost than a single biscuit?

Let’s make a system of equation
b = biscuit, c = carton of milk
2b + c = 5.00
3b + c = 6.50
Now use elimination subtract
-1b = -1.5
b = $1.50
2(1.50) + c = 5
3 + c = 5, c= $2.00
Solution: $0.50 more
